I have no willpower to write segments of stuff about how this soundtrack just isn't for the likes of me. For the likes of me, who, when want cheerful music, expect some sort of catchyness to the songs.
That isn't the bad kind. Under the Sea melts your brain. Agrabah irritates with its trivial wannabe-arabesque dance mat music. There's something good, though. More traditional RPG-ish music like Traverse Town and the cheesy vocal theme Simple and Clean's instrumental versions, Peter Pan -sequence music and some of the choral work later in the game.
There's something, but not even nearly enough for me to enjoy a two-disc filler-infested soundtrack to a game that I otherwise love. This is Kingdom Hearts's only con.
2/5, barely
